Analysis

The most recent figure for electricity installed capacity, megawatt in Egypt is 53,360, measured in 2023. That is the highest value across all 24 years on record.

Compared with earlier readings it is up 82.6% over ten years.

Over the whole period, electricity installed capacity, megawatt in Egypt peaked at 53,360 in 2021 and was at its lowest, 14,181, in 2002.

That places Egypt 13th out of 224 countries with data for 2023, putting it in the top 10%.

The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 24 years of available data.

Electricity Installed Capacity, Megawatt in Egypt, year by year

Annual values for Electricity Installed Capacity, Megawatt (Fossil fuels) in Egypt, 2000 to 2023.
Year Value Change
2000 14,356
2001 14,349 -0.0%
2002 14,181 -1.2%
2003 15,917 +12.2%
2004 16,535 +3.9%
2005 18,169 +9.9%
2006 19,619 +8.0%
2007 20,119 +2.5%
2008 20,960 +4.2%
2009 22,119 +5.5%
2010 24,245 +9.6%
2011 26,275 +8.4%
2012 28,000 +6.6%
2013 29,215 +4.3%
2014 29,215 +0.0%
2015 31,662 +8.4%
2016 35,266 +11.4%
2017 41,396 +17.4%
2018 50,942 +23.1%
2019 52,744 +3.5%
2020 53,243 +0.9%
2021 53,360 +0.2%
2022 53,360 +0.0%
2023 53,360 +0.0%

This dataset provides information on electricity generation and installed capacity, categorized by energy type (renewable and non-renewable) and five technology types (Fossil fuels, Hydropower, Solar energy, Wind energy, and Bioenergy). The data has been sourced from the International Renewable Energy Agency (https://pxweb.irena.org/pxweb/en/IRENASTAT). The indicators on energy transition have been formulated to help users understand the progress in the adoption of renewable energy sources vis-à-vis the increasing energy requirements.
